What is Average Rate of Return? The Average Rate of Return is a financial metric used to evaluate the yield of an investment over its holding period. The ARR is expressed as a percentage and is calculated over multiple periods to provide a comprehensive view of an investment's performance. To clarify, the ARR considers: Initial Investment Net Returns The duration of the investment In practical applications, ARR aids investors in comparing the profitability of different investments, guiding them in making informed decisions. Usefulness of Average Rate of Return Understanding the average rate of return is crucial for several reasons: Performance Evaluation: ARR allows investors to evaluate the performance of their investments over time. Comparative Analysis: It provides a standard metric for comparing different investment opportunities. Informed Decision-Making: With accurate ARR calculations, investors can make more informed decisions about where to allocate their funds. Advantages of Using ARR Simplicity: The formula is easy to understand and use, making it accessible for investors of all levels. Time Frame Flexibility: The average rate of return can be calculated over various time frames, allowing investors to observe short-term and long-term performance. Limitations of ARR Ignores Cash Flow Timing: ARR does not account for the time value of money or when cash flows occur. Single Metric: Solely relying on ARR could oversimplify complex investment decisions, ignoring factors such as market conditions and risk. A Comparative Approach: ARR vs. Other Metrics To gain a better understanding of the average rate of return, it is essential to compare it with other financial metrics: Metric Description Usefulness Average Rate of Return (ARR) Overall profitability of an investment over time Simple and straightforward analysis Compound Annual Growth Rate (CAGR) Average annual growth rate over a period More precise as it accounts for growth rates over time Internal Rate of Return (IRR) Discount rate that makes the net present value of a project zero Useful for comparing the profitability of investments with varying cash flows While the ARR is essential for basic evaluations, these other metrics can provide deeper insights into investment performance.
